#' Encode data.frame of factors using One-Hot Encoding
#'
#' @author David Senhora Navega
#' @export
#'
#' @param data a data.frame where all components are factors.
#' @param sep a character defining the separator used for naming the columns of
#' encoded data.
#' @return a matrix with encode factors.
#'
encode <- function(data, sep = ": ") {
m <- ncol(data)
vnames <- colnames(data)
if (!is.data.frame(data))
stop("\n(-) data must be a data.frame object")
if (any(!sapply(data,is.factor)))
stop("\n(-) All columns of data must be factors.")
if (inherits(data, c("tbl_df", "tbl"))) {
data <- as.data.frame(data)
colnames(data) <- vnames
}
encoder <- function(x) {
n <- length(x)
m <- nlevels(x)
encoding_matrix <- matrix(0, nrow = n, ncol = m)
ones <- (1L:n) + n * (unclass(x) - 1L)
encoding_matrix[ones] <- 1
colnames(encoding_matrix) <- levels(x)
mode(encoding_matrix) <- "integer"
return(encoding_matrix)
}
encoded_list <- lapply(data, encoder)
named_list <- lapply(seq_len(m), function(mth) {
encoded_matrix <- encoded_list[[mth]]
n <- ncol(encoded_matrix)
colnames(encoded_matrix) <- paste0(
vnames[mth], sep = sep, colnames(encoded_matrix)
)
return(encoded_matrix)
})
encoded <- do.call(cbind, named_list)
return(encoded)
}
